For consignment, a 1993 Chevrolet Van 20 Rockwood conversion with a title verified 112,003 actual miles. While this is not configured like a camper, it does feel like a comfortable living room on wheels which will turn normal commutes into magic carpet rides for passengers, front and rear.

Exterior
Stripes and graphics were a big deal in the early 90's and this one hasn't lost its period charm, decked out with Beige Metallic and Radisson Red Metallic paint in stripes, lines, and bold graphic shapes. The red roof has a luggage rack and the spare mounted on the back has a matching cover next to the ladder connected to the rear barn door. Windows differentiate this from a regular van with many, large, camper style windows including those built into the side and rear doors, and they're all tinted. A black grille and dual headlights front the van and we note the hood has some peeling clear coat. The 15-inch wheels carry 225/75R15 tires with a mid 2023 date code and Rockwood is expressed on the rear side panels. Condition wise, we'd rate this as good with some general patina throughout, a loose windshield seal, oxidation on the roof panel, filler repair, scratches, and lots of rust bubbles around the wheel openings and fenders.

Interior
Tan and burgundy make up the interior palette with all door panels and seats covered with tan cloth in varying textures and all in fine condition. The seats have the added enhancement of duvet-like extensions that hide the seat hardware and the second row consists of bucket seats, the third is a bench that folds down flat. A standard steering wheel leads to a basic gauge cluster in a brushed aluminum faceplate, all surrounded with burgundy textured plastic, the type that was ubiquitous in GM 80's and 90's vehicles. A Delco AM/FM/Cassette radio resides in the center stack over some storage bins and tan carpet a bit too short to call shag, but not far off. The beige headliner above is held in place with wooden rails while Levolor type blinds cover the side windows.

Drivetrain
Partially visible under the hood, we find driver quality conditions of GM's 4.3 liter V6, rated at 165 horsepower and fuel injected. It's mated to a 4L60E 4-speed automatic transmission that sends power to the 10 bolt axle with 3.42 gears.

Undercarriage
Surface rust prevails underneath with a spot of some pitted stuff on part of the frame.There is some residual oil on the pan and a drop by the driveshaft, but overall the underside is clean. Power brakes are onboard as front disc and rear drum and a single exhaust flows through a Dynomax muffler before exiting. Suspension consists of coil springs in front and leaf springs in back.

Drive-Ability
Upon starting and slightly accelerating, we note an engine knock so we quickly check functionality of switches, lights, and other items and all operate as intended.
